SCOTT SAN DIEGO RACE REPORT
Salt Lake City, UT February 9, 2015 – Supercross entered a new venue Saturday night as Petco Park in San Diego, California hosted round 6 of the Monster Energy Supercross Series. Scott athletes Trey Canard and Tyler Bowers started off the day right in qualifying practice with Trey logging the 5th fastest lap time in the 450 class and Tyler taking the pole position with the fastest lap in the 250 class.
Trey Canard
Trey Canard qualified into the main event with a 3rd place finish in his heat race. At the end of the first lap in the main event Trey was in 2nd place. On lap 4 he made his move on the leader, took over the lead and never looked back. Trey brought home his second win on the season and his second in 3 weeks.
Tyler Bowers
Tyler Bowers lead the majority of the 250 main but with 6 laps to go he was overtaken. He would go on to finish 3rd place and finish on the podium.
